It's Over! What a GREAT Festival !!! - Monday, June 15, 2009

What a GREAT Festival! 

We had Super Callers and a Super Cuer all weekend and great dancers having a wonderful time Square Dancing and Round Dancing.  I have put a photo (Last Dance at GSI in England 2009) on the download area (above) so that you can see the caller coaches all on stage at the same time.  

We all had so much fun dancing and socializing.  There were dancers, callers and Cuers at the festival from all over Western Europe, Russia, Japan and the United States.  We made so many new friends that we will never forget.  Already we are looking forward to the next GSI Festival in Franfort, Germany in June of 2010, and then the posibility of going to a GSI Festival in Australia in 2011.  Now we can't stop.  We have to keep visiting our new friends.

 
GSI-UK 2009 Update - Monday, November 03, 2008

The GSI-UK team keeps going from strength to strength. After two sold out “launch” dances we are well on the way with plans for the 2009 GSI-UK Festival. Our website has been up and running for some time now, so information about the Festival, calling and cueing staff, registration, accommodations, and the program for the weekend can all be found on this web site.

The October issue of “Lets Square Dance” has a 2009 Festival registration form in the centre fold, all you need to do is pull it out, fill it out and send it in! Don’t wait because the early bird price is only good until 31 January 2009; register now and save £14 per couple off the full weekend price.

 
Next year we have the same terrific calling and cueing staff with one exception. Deborah Carroll-Jones will be joining us for 2009. Deborah has one of the most amazing voices in calling and you don’t want to miss her.
 
The 2009 program has a few changes from 2007. We have removed C1 and added more of everything else, more Mainstream, more Plus, more Advanced, and a lot more Rounds. We are planning after parties on Friday & Saturday night again, (those of you who were at the 2007 festival might remember Tony Oxendine in a wig and skirt)! The venue for 2009 is the same one we used in 2007, the St Ivo Leisure Centre, St Ives, Cambridgeshire. This is one of the best venues in the UK, three halls, lots of room to dance, and the main hall is air conditioned. Food is available on site. The venue has plenty of parking and is close to the centre of St Ives. Campgrounds are also only a few minutes drive away.
We have two shops arranged for 2009. Phil & Zoe will be back with us again and Katie & Willem Koster will be returning with their shop “Tulip Country” Western Wear. Just about anything you can imagine for Square Dancing is available from these two shops.
 
For all you Callers and Cuers; This year for the very first time GSI is sponsoring a Cuers school as well as our international Callers school. Both schools will take place 7 -11 June 2009 in the same venue as the festival. We have five of the top caller coaches in the world and an internationally known Cuer instructor. Both schools will feature sessions for experienced as well as new callers and cuers. This is a full week of top notch training and it is FREE! That’s right, absolutely free, no tuition cost whatsoever. All you pay are your own expenses. The Callers school is already over 50% full so don’t wait to register if you want to attend. Registration will open up for callers outside the UK very shortly and we fully expect the school to be completely booked. Cuers, space is very limited as we only have one Cuer instructor. Priority at any GSI school is given to those who have never attended any previous GSI school.
